Brain scans led to a wrongful murder conviction in a shocking case

Gad Saad highlights a disturbing instance where fMRI evidence contributed to a woman's wrongful conviction for murder. This misuse of brain imaging technology showcases the peril of overinterpreting scientific data, creating a false sense of understanding complex legal issues.
